Logistics Checklist: Setup, Communication, and Guest Comfort
Great performances depend on smart logistics. Confirm arrival and setup requirements with your booking contact, including when sound checks should happen and who will be your on-site point of contact. Review space considerations like sightlines for guests and where the musician can move comfortably without disrupting the event. Check whether you need microphones or specific connections for announcements. Plan for lighting and background ambience so the saxophone sound sits beautifully in the mix. Finally, prepare a simple timeline for the host—when the performance begins, any key moments to spotlight, and how to handle schedule changes without stress.
